Public Enterprises Minister Pravin Gordhan has threatened to take Parliament to court for proposing that the SIU investigate the SAA deal.

The Public Enterprises Minister wrote a letter to Parliament on Wednesday morning.has threatened to take Parliament to court for proposing that the Special Investigating Unit look into the collapsed deal between South African Airways being appointed as the transactional advisor in the initial phase.

It is alleged that RMB had identified four companies on its shortlist – and Harith and Global Aviation was not one of them.Later, the Department of Public Enterprises set up an evaluation committee to handle the shortlisting process after RMB pulled out as transaction advisers. The department did not advertise for another company to do the work and according to the committee, Gordhan has not provided a credible response to this particular allegation.Now the committee believes Gordhan and his department has not provided sufficient reasons as to why an internal team was appointed as the advisor or why Takatso had been shortlisted in the second phase of the transaction.

Additionally, the committee indicated that it cannot whether the SAA deal was “above board” and will, therefore, recommend that law enforcement agencies “do their work in unravelling the truth about this transaction” particularly the alleged forgery of Tlhakudi’s signature in the strategic equity partner appointment process.
